The Economy Watchers Survey's Current Conditions Diffusion Index (DI) is an indicator that shows the current state of the economy. Conducted by the Cabinet Office, this survey gathers insights from individuals in retail, services, manufacturing, and other sectors, particularly reflecting regional economic trends.
The DI is benchmarked at zero, with positive values indicating that the economy is judged to be in good condition, and negative values indicating that the economy is judged to be in poor condition. An increasing Current Conditions DI suggests that the economy is recovering or expanding, while a decreasing DI suggests that the economy is stagnating or contracting.
This data serves as a reference for policymakers to assess the current economic situation and formulate appropriate policies. Additionally, it is an important source of information for businesses and investors to understand the current state of the economy.
